What Happens During the Trials? The goal is for each dog to complete three events within the 8-minute time limit: 1. The “Dockside Obstacle Course” — Dog and handler negotiate a maze of lobster traps, piles of rope, buoys, and other funky dockside paraphernalia. 2. The “Dinghy Hop” — Dog and handler scramble in and out of a very unstable dinghy that’s tethered to a float. 3. The “Freestyle” segment — Each dog (and their person) shows off his or her special talents….No holds are barred during this segment.

Are There Any Rules? Only Three: Rule #1: Either dog or handler must finish the contest completely soaked. Rule #2: Cheating is not only tolerated but encouraged. Rule #3: The freestyle event must incorporate 2 items in some fashion: a Frisbee, and a lobster toy. You are encouraged to be creative! Rule #4: There are no other rules.
